1. Understanding Interdisciplinary Requirements | 理解跨学科要求
The CAIE Drama syllabus (9482) expects learners to analyse plays, productions, and devised work through multiple lenses. A high-scoring response does more than describe; it integrates history, psychology, sociology, and aesthetics. For example, when examining Ibsen’s A Doll’s House, a candidate must connect the 19th-century Norwegian marriage laws (history) to Nora’s psychological awakening and the symbolic set design (aesthetics).

Examiners look for explicit links between production elements and contextual ideas. You can practise by asking: “How does the socio-political context shape directorial choices?” or “What psychological theory illuminates a character’s objective?” These bridging questions turn a standard essay into an interdisciplinary argument.

2. Literary Analysis: Text and Subtext | 文学分析:文本与潜台词
Every theatrical performance begins with the script. Close reading skills from English Literature are essential for unpacking dialogue, imagery, and structure. In CAIE essay questions, you might be asked to explore how a playwright uses language to reveal character or theme. Pay attention to metre, rhetorical devices, and dramatic irony.

Consider Shakespeare’s Hamlet. The famous ‘To be, or not to be’ soliloquy is not just philosophical reflection; its iambic disruptions and antitheses mirror Hamlet’s fractured psyche. Your answer should link that textual analysis to performance choices — pace, breath, gesture — creating a bridge from page to stage.

3. Historical Context: Period and Theatrical Style | 历史语境:时代背景与戏剧风格
Placing a play in its original historical moment is a baseline requirement. But interdisciplinary thinking demands that you also analyse how later productions reinterpret the work for new audiences. For instance, Brecht’s Mother Courage responds to the Thirty Years’ War, yet contemporary stagings often draw parallels with modern conflicts, highlighting the cyclical nature of war profiteering.

When revising, create timelines for each set text that include political events, artistic movements (Expressionism, Naturalism, Absurdism), and key social reforms. Then ask: how would a director in 2025 highlight these links? Use specific staging examples, such as projections of historical footage or period costume juxtaposed with modern dress.

4. Psychological Lens: Character Motivation and Emotional Truth | 心理学视角:角色动机与情感真实
Stanislavski’s system and later psychological approaches (like Uta Hagen’s or Adler’s) ground character-building in genuine human behaviour. In an exam, you can draw on psychological concepts such as Freud’s id, ego, superego, or attachment theory to explain a character’s journey. This not only shows sophistication but also directly addresses assessment objectives relating to interpretation.

An example: analysing Blanche DuBois in A Streetcar Named Desire, a candidate could describe her defence mechanisms (denial, projection) and connect them to trauma. The actor’s performance then becomes a physicalisation of psychological conflict, through trembling hands, vocal fragility, or avoidance of direct eye contact.

5. Sociological Perspective: Group Dynamics and Social Critique | 社会学视角:群体动态与社会批判
Theatre is always embedded in social structures. A sociological reading examines power relations, class, gender performance, and collective behaviour. CAIE questions might ask you to discuss how a play critiques societal norms or how an ensemble piece represents group identity.

In Caryl Churchill’s Top Girls, the overlapping dialogue and non-naturalistic structure reject patriarchal language patterns. Linking this to sociology, you can reference Pierre Bourdieu’s notion of ‘cultural capital’ to explore how the characters navigate a male-dominated world through speech and behaviour. On stage, props and blocking can reinforce these dynamics — for instance, a large boardroom table dominating the space.

6. Political Interpretation: Power and Ideology | 政治解读:权力与意识形态
Most plays are political, whether explicitly agitprop or implicitly reinforcing the status quo. Interdisciplinary answers should identify ideological frameworks — Marxism, feminism, postcolonialism — and demonstrate how theatrical elements communicate these. Brecht’s epic theatre is a direct political tool, using alienation effects to wake the audience from passive consumption.

When tackling a political question, avoid vague statements. Instead, detail the set: a raised platform for authority figures, stark lighting that exposes rulers’ faces, or fragmented staging that mirrors a fractured society. Mention specific moments of audience interaction or provocation.

7. Visual Arts and Scenography | 视觉艺术与舞美设计
Set, costume, lighting, and projection design draw heavily from visual arts movements — Bauhaus, Surrealism, Constructivism. In a CAIE answer, you should explain how aesthetic choices create meaning, not just atmosphere. For example, a Surrealist set for The Caucasian Chalk Circle might use distorted perspectives to challenge notions of justice.

Practise describing visual elements with precise terminology: colour palette, texture, scale, perspective. Then bridge to interpretation. A costume that mixes Victorian lace with punk elements in a production of Woyzeck instantly signals social hybridity and oppression across eras.

8. Music and Sound Design: Emotional and Semiotic Layers | 音乐与声音设计:情感与符号层次
Sound is often under-explored in student essays, yet it offers a powerful interdisciplinary link with musicology, psychology, and cultural studies. Diegetic and non-diegetic sound, leitmotifs, and sonic textures shape audience reception. Reference the work of sound designers or composers where relevant.

For instance, in a production of The Crucible, an electronic drone beneath the dialogue can evoke an oppressive theocratic state, while sudden silence during accusations isolates the accused. Discuss how tempo and volume create psychophysiological responses — heart rate increase, tension — linking to psychological theories of arousal.

9. Technology and Multimedia Integration | 科技与多媒体融合
Contemporary productions increasingly use digital media: live feeds, projection mapping, virtual reality. CAIE expects candidates to engage with current theatre practice. When writing about a hypothetical staging of a set text, you could propose a multimedia approach that comments on surveillance culture or digital alienation.

A response on Ibsen’s An Enemy of the People might propose a set covered in live-screening monitors displaying social media reactions; this would thread the 1882 critique of majority tyranny into the 21st-century context of online shaming. Always justify your choices by linking technology’s effects to thematic concerns.

10. Intercultural Theatre and Global Perspectives | 跨文化戏剧与全球视角
CAIE encourages awareness of diverse theatrical traditions. An interdisciplinary essay might compare a Western text’s adaptation using Eastern performance techniques — such as Noh, Kathakali, or Peking Opera — not as cultural ornamentation but as a legitimate lens for examining universal themes.

When discussing Medea, a director could fuse Greek tragedy with Balinese topeng mask work to externalise Medea’s psychological duality. This approach requires understanding both traditions’ philosophies of performance and ritual. Make sure to reference practitioners like Peter Brook or Ariane Mnouchkine, who have pioneered such intercultural dialogues.

11. Integrated Question Samples and Response Strategy | 综合题型示例与答题策略
Typical CAIE questions read: “Discuss how you would stage a production of [play title] that highlights its socio-historical context to a modern audience.” Your plan should merge context, concept, and creative decisions. Start by articulating a clear directorial intention (the “big idea”), then spiral out into acting style, design, sound, and use of space.

Structure your essay using PEEL (Point-Evidence-Explanation-Link) but adapt it for drama: State your production concept, give specific stage example, explain the intended effect on audience, and link back to the interdisciplinary angle (e.g., Marxist reading of class).

| Essay Component | Example Response (Brecht’s Galileo) |
|---|---|
| Director’s concept | Explore the conflict between scientific truth and institutional power. |
| Staging example | White laboratory floor gradually covered by red banners of the Church. |
| Interdisciplinary link | Connects to history (Galileo’s recantation) and politics (ideological control). |
Table: Applying an interdisciplinary structure to staging essays | 表格:在舞台设计论文中应用跨学科结构
Time management is crucial. In a 60-minute essay, spend 10 minutes brainstorming interdisciplinary connections across 3 domains (history, psychology, visual art), then weave them into a coherent narrative rather than listing them.

12. Practice Prompts and Self-Assessment Checklist | 模拟题训练与自我评估清单
Regular practice with unseen prompts builds the agility needed to integrate disciplines under time pressure. Use the following checkpoints to evaluate your drafts:

- Contextual integration: Have I moved beyond obvious historical dates to link societal attitudes to performance choices?

- Psychological depth: Have I explained character behaviour using a named theory or practitioner?

- Aesthetic coherence: Do my design elements (set, costume, sound) stem from a unified concept that echoes the interdisciplinary analysis?

- Critical vocabulary: Have I used terms like semiotics, verfremdungseffekt, subtext, proxemics accurately?
